WebSoybean protein is the only complete plant protein; that is, it contains all of the amino acids essential for human health. However, it is somewhat low in the amino acids methionine and cystine, but these can be supplemented by eating whole grains (wheat, rye, brown rice, etc.), fish or casein (milk protein).
